Plot summary the kugelmass episode essay

“The Kugelmass Episode” opens with Kugelmass, a middle-aged, unhappily committed humanities mentor seeking the advice of his analyst, Doctor Mandel. He is bored with his your life, and he needs to have an affair. His expert disagrees, however , telling him “there is no overnight cure” pertaining to his problems, adding that he is “an analyst, certainly not a magician. ” Kugelmass after that seeks out a magician to help him fix his problem.

A few weeks later, he gets a call through the Great Persky, a two-bit magician/entertainer who reveals him a “cheap-looking Chinese pantry, badly lacquered” that can travel the professor into any book, short story, enjoy, or poem to meet the woman figure of his choice.

When he has had enough, Kugelmass just has to give a yell and he is back in New York. At first Kugelmass thinks it is a scam, then that Persky is crazy, however for $20, he gives it a try. He wants a French lover, so he chooses Emma Bovary.

Persky throws a paperback replicate of Flaubert’s story into the pantry with Kugelmass, taps it three times, and Kugelmass discovers himself at the Bovary estate in Yonville in the French countryside.

Emma Bovary welcomes Kugelmass, flirting with him as she admires his modern gown. “It’s referred to as a leisure suit, “‘ he replies romantically, then adds, “It was marked down. “‘ They beverage wine, have a stroll through the countryside, and whisper to each other as they recline below a tree. As they kiss and embrace, Kugelmass remembers that he has a date to meet his wife, Daphne. He tells Emma he will go back as soon as possible, calls for Persky, and is transported back to New York. His heart is light, and he thinks he is in love. What he doesn’t know is that learners across the country are asking their teachers regarding the unusual appearance of a “bald Jew” getting Madame Bovary on page 95.

The next day, Kugelmass returns to Persky, who carries him to Flaubert’s novel to be with Emma. All their affair goes on for some weeks. Kugelmass explains to Persky to always get him into the book before webpage 120, when the character Rodolphe appears. During their time collectively, Emma complains about her husband, Charles, and her dull non-urban existence.

Kugelmass tells her about life back in New York, with its nightlife, fast cars, and movie and TV stars. Emma wants to go to New York and become an actress. Kugelmass arranges it with Persky the fact that next liaison with Emma is in New You are able to. He tells Daphne that he will be attending a symposium in Boston, and the next afternoon, Emma comes to New You are able to. They spend a wonderfully loving weekend jointly, and Emma has never been as happy. Meanwhile, a Stanford professor, studying Flaubert’s publication, cannot “get his head around” the alterations that have taken place to the novel: First a strange character known as Kugelmass shows up, and then it character disappears.

When Persky tries to return Emma to the novel, his cabinet failures, and she is forced to stay in New You are able to. Kugelmass discovers himself working between Daphne and Emma, paying Emma’s enormous lodge bills, and having to put up with his lover’s pouting and despondence, and the anxiety begins to wear him out. He learns also that a colleague who is jealous of him, Fivish Kopkind, has spotted Kugelmass in the publication and offers threatened to reveal his key to Daphne. He wants to commit committing suicide or run away. But the equipment is fixed at last, and Kugelmass rushes Emma to Persky’s and in the end back to the novel. Kugelmass says he has learned his lesson and definitely will never defraud again.

Yet Kugelmass is at Persky’s door once again three several weeks later. He is bored and wishes another affair. Persky alerts him which the machine is not in use because the earlier “unpleasantness, ” but Kugelmass says he wants to do it, and requires to enter Portnoy’s Complaint. But the cabinet blows up, Persky is thrown back and has a fatal heart attack, and his home goes up in flames. …
